Join the Global Business Intelligence and Analytics team to translate data into actionable insights that inform sales, marketing, and product strategies for Asset and Wealth Management. You will partner with product, sales, and marketing to deliver a 360° client view, build enablement tools, and develop client dashboards and segmentation frameworks. The role includes prototyping basic statistical or machine learning models (e.g., propensity, churn, next-best-action) and driving AI-enabled insights and processes. Strong communication and data storytelling are essential to turn analytics into actionable business recommendations.

Location: New York, NY, United States

Join our dynamic Global Business Intelligence and Analytics team, where you'll play a crucial role in transforming data into actionable insights. We're seeking strategic thinkers with technical prowess and a passion for storytelling to drive sales and marketing strategies through innovative applications and predictive analytics. Be part of a team that shapes the future with data-driven excellence! 

As a Marketing Analytics Analyst – Business Intelligence within Asset and Wealth Management, you will partner across product, sales, and marketing to build and deliver a 360° client view through client analytics and performance reporting. You will work closely with business and marketing management to measure the health of the business, make informed data-driven strategic recommendations, and deliver intelligence directly into the hands of product, sales, and marketing teams. The ideal candidate has experience working with large data sets, is highly driven, detail-oriented, analytical, organized, and an effective communicator. 

The Global Business Intelligence and Analytics team has grown exponentially over the last 10 years as the organization has matured from data-guided to data-driven. Our team’s input is critical not only in the analysis stage of objective-setting but also through the enablement and execution of those objectives. The team’s remit spans developing sales/marketing enablement applications, data modeling, sales and marketing strategy, predictive analytics, and more. This unique position requires all team members to be technically proficient, strategic, curious, outcome-oriented, and excellent narrators. 

Job Responsibilities 

  • Deliver analytical insights that provide a 360° view of client behavior and performance across product, sales, and marketing to inform audience targeting, product positioning, campaign planning, and investment decisions for management priorities. 

  • Build and maintain enablement tools that curate key recommendations to product, sales, and marketing teams, unifying data across CRM, product usage/adoption, pipeline, and marketing engagement. 

  • Develop and operationalize client 360 dashboards and segmentation frameworks to support distribution and growth objectives. 

  • Drive new AI enablement insights, capabilities, and processes. 

  • Conduct data analyses and prototype basic statistical or machine learning models (e.g., propensity, churn, next-best-action). 

  • Work with technology teams to define data strategy and build data models, including data lineage and governance exercises, and integrate new data sources where needed. 

  • Translate insights into actionable recommendations aligned to business strategy, with emphasis on the Alternatives growth agenda. 

 

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ills 

  • BA/BS degree – major/minor in business, analytics, data science, AI, or related fields plus 2+ years of coding experience (Python, PySpark, and SQL) 

  • Familiarity with Asset Management and/or distribution organizations 

  • Comfort working in agile product teams 

  • Experience developing KPIs, especially for campaign and marketing functions 

  • A highly effective communicator and adept at stakeholder management 

  • Comfort in working flexibly and iteratively with large sets of data 

  • Strong analytical skills 

  • AI literacy and understanding, particularly for enabling new intelligence and sales tools 

  • Multi-talented, high-energy individual that will help create, coordinate, and execute on our strategic priorities across sales, analytics, and technology 

 

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ills 

  • Interest in roles within data analytics/strategy; asset management preferred 

  • Strong time management and organizational skills 

  • Ability to adapt to shifting priorities, requirements, and timelines by utilizing problem-solving skills 

  • Proficient with Excel and PowerPoint; SQL and/or Python experience strongly preferred 

  • Dashboard development and visualization: proficient in designing, building, and maintaining interactive dashboards using tools such as Tableau, Power BI, or Qlik to effectively communicate insights and analyses to stakeholders 

  • Any prior experience in the Alternatives investment industry or Asset Management industry is a plus
